1. DxSale suspected of "self-dealing theft": Over $7.3 million LP drained
The veteran project launch platform DxSale on BNB Chain was pointed out by on-chain security analysis that its team may have used a reserved backdoor to withdraw funds from liquidity pools locked in 2021, involving over 1,400 LP pools and approximately $7.3 million. The attack path includes silent ownership transfer and over 80 wallet jumps, with fund flows directly linked to DxSale team wallets. If true, this means the platform may have embedded a theft mechanism years ago. Such incidents directly undermine investor trust in DeFi infrastructure and locking protocols, potentially triggering panic withdrawals from similar platforms.

4. Robinhood joins Trump’s "Children’s Investment Account" plan, HOOD rises 11.29%
Robinhood will act as a trustee in the U.S. government-supported children's investment account program, providing tax-advantaged accounts for eligible children under 18, with an initial $1,000 funded by the Treasury. The project is expected to launch on July 4. This marks the deep integration of compliant crypto trading platforms into the traditional financial system, which could bring sustained incremental capital inflows to the market in the long term, though in the short term, it is more about institutional recognition of the system.
5. Crypto trading firm FalconX files IPO application with SEC
Institutional-grade crypto bulk broker FalconX has secretly submitted an S-1 registration statement to go public. The company was valued at $8 billion in 2022 and serves hedge funds and market makers. Another crypto infrastructure firm moving toward the public market indicates that despite bearish market sentiment, institutional service providers are still advancing compliance and capitalization processes, reflecting increasing maturity of industry infrastructure.
6. Sui: Mainnet has resumed operation after crash caused by version 1.72 gas fee logic bug
The Sui mainnet resumed early this morning after being halted due to a bug in the gas fee logic introduced in version 1.72. Although this Layer 1 technical failure was quickly fixed, it exposed testing blind spots in the upgrade process, which could temporarily impact Sui’s reputation for reliability. Developer ecosystem confidence remains to be observed.
